2. Layered Sheer and Opaque Curtains
I once struggled with light control in my living room until I layered sheer curtains with a heavier opaque set. It gave me flexibility — sunlight during the day and privacy at night.
This works because layering combines the best of both worlds: sheers soften light, and opaque panels control privacy. It’s perfect for rooms with large windows or direct sunlight.
Pair sheer curtains with matching or complementary opaque drapes and use tiebacks to create a polished, elegant look.
Styling Essentials:
- Choose contrasting textures
- Use curtain tiebacks for style
- Match with rugs or cushions

5. Floor-to-Ceiling Sheer Curtains for Drama
I used floor-to-ceiling sheer curtains in my first apartment, and the tall windows suddenly looked more luxurious and elegant. The curtains added height and movement to the room.
This works because tall curtains elongate windows and make the space feel larger and more sophisticated. They create a dramatic focal point without heavy fabrics.
Use this style with long curtain rods, light furniture, and minimal accessories to emphasize height and elegance.
Key Tips:
- Choose lightweight fabrics
- Ensure rod extends past window frame
- Keep surrounding décor simple

13. Layered Sheer with Roman Shades
In my small apartment, I layered sheer curtains over Roman shades. The result was chic, functional, and flexible — privacy at night, light by day.
This works because layering sheers with shades gives control over light and privacy while keeping the airy feel of sheer curtains. Perfect for urban apartments or multifunctional rooms.
Combine with minimal furniture, simple décor, and neutral tones for a modern, practical look.
Styling Tips:
- Use neutral shades under sheers
- Coordinate curtain rods and hardware
- Keep accessories simple
